Texas bill to eliminate vehicle inspection requirement headed to Gov. Abbott’s desk

Rebecca Noel

Posted on May 23, 2023 · While the bill would do away with yearly safety inspections required for vehicle registration, drivers in 17 Texas counties would still need to get annual emissions tests, including Harris County.

Should Texas End its Vehicle Inspection Requirement?

Abner Fletcher

Posted on March 31, 2017 · Should Texas end its vehicle inspection requirement? State Sen. Don Huffines has authored and introduced SB 1588, which would end the mandatory annual vehicle safety inspection — checking the lights, the brakes, the horn and so forth. To him, it's a waste of taxpayer money and not necessarily about safety. The Texas State Inspection Association […]
